The Charm of Sliding Doors

Sliding doors are a great addition to any home. They are not only aesthetically pleasing, but also practical. The design is simple yet stylish, making them suitable for a variety of home decor styles. Their functionality cannot be overstated – sliding doors save space as they don’t require swing room, and they provide an uninterrupted view of the outside. They also allow for better ventilation and more natural light in your home. Many sliding doors come with energy-efficient features, making them a sustainable choice for homeowners.

Patio Doors – Enhancing Your Home

Patio doors are designed to provide a large entrance to your outdoor living space, enhancing the overall ambiance of your home. They can be either sliding or hinged and are available in a variety of styles and materials, such as wood, vinyl, aluminum, or fiberglass. Patio doors are known for their durability and security features. They also have excellent insulation properties, ensuring that your home remains warm in winter and cool in summer. Patio doors can dramatically increase your home’s curb appeal, making it more attractive to potential buyers should you decide to sell.
